
Former NXT Tag Team Champion Giovanni Vinci (fka Fabian Aichner) has commented following his recent gimmick change.
The ex-Imperium member returned to NXT TV on Tuesday’s (June 14) episode, defeating Guru Raaj in singles action
WWE NXT has now shared a digital exclusive backstage interview with Vinci, in which Vinci noted that NXT was in a desperate need for some style, and that he’s in a league of his own.
He finished the promo with his new catchphrase ‘Veni, Vidi, Vinci’, a play on ‘Veni, Vidi, Vici’, Latin for ‘I came, I saw, I conquered’.
Vinci last appeared on NXT TV as Fabian Aichner on the April 5 episode, walking out on his tag partner Marcel Barthel during their bout against the Creed Brothers.
Barthel has since debuted on the main roster as ‘Ludwig Kaiser’, alongside Gunther, who defeated Ricochet for the Intercontinental Championship on last week’s episode of SmackDown.
